**Q: Why does the Quillbook spreadsheet export spike memory before a release?**

A: The exporter materializes the full workbook in memory before streaming. Large tenants (50k+ rows) can push a worker past 6 GB, which triggers OOM kills during release smoke tests. Mitigation: raise the worker memory limit or enable chunked export behind the `export_stream` flag. Don't block a release on a single OOM; two or more means hold. Per-tenant sizing guidance is on the internal page below.

operations page: https://jenkins.zemvarcloud.local/job/merge_requests/repo/build/73930b4b30f0a8ed

MEMO — Kettling Depot Receiving

Uniform sets for the new Kettling depot arrive Wednesday via Ashgrove courier: 40 boxes, sorted by size, manifest attached to box one. Check the count at the dock before signing; shortages go straight to stores, not the courier. The hand-over instruction the courier will follow is set out below.

drop instructions, tafof-baguf: the holmir gilox courier leaves the sormir ulaok holdor ledger at gate 5596 under passcode 257343

## Deployment: Order Cutoff Rule

Heads up for review: Crumbwright's bakery platform enforces an order cutoff so the kitchen in Marlow Hollow isn't flooded after prep starts. The cutoff check runs server-side in the order service — the frontend countdown is cosmetic, so don't treat it as a control. Requests after cutoff are rejected with a signed denial record for audit. Clock source is the deployment host, so NTP drift matters here; flag anything sketchy. The enforcement values deployed right now are these.

deployment values, bafog-tajop:
NOVAEL_PIN=7103
NOVAEL_TENANT=weneth
NOVAEL_METRICS_HOST=metrics.novael.crelvocorp.corp
NOVAEL_SEAL=seal_be72a3d3
NOVAEL_STANDBY_TEAM=caseth